Summary

Persistent polyclonal B cell lymphocytosis (PPBL) involves expanded B cells but shows normal proliferation and immunoglobulin secretion via CD40-CD154 activation. This suggests potential microenvironment or alternative pathway defects, not inherent B cell dysfunction.
